Treatment of Bolivian L Braziliensis Mucosal Leishmaniasis with Inhaled Pentamidine Plus Oral Miltefosine

NCT06550609 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 30

Last updated 2025-02-26

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This is a phase 2 study of the combination of inhaled-pentamidine plus oral miltefosine for Bolivian mucosal leishmaniasis.

Conditions

  • Mucosal Leishmaniasis

Interventions

DRUG

Miltefosine Oral Capsule

Miltefosine 3 pill per day during 28 days AND pentamidine inhaled 300 mg / d during 10 dosis
